Five workers on a crane to ask for the money that they are entitled to

Protest by five workers that ends at 2.00 p.m. after the mediation of the trade union

Five workers on a crane to ask for the money owed to them. They are 4 Kosovars and a Jordanian employees of "Sabina Earth", a building company based in Brescia, engaged in the construction of the San Quirico enclosures of residences in via San Rocco in Cavaria. They arrived this morning, on Wednesday, from the province of Brescia, where they lived, out of desperation not knowing how to pay the gas and electricity bills.  This morning, March 20, at about 10, they climbed on a crane within the work area with a sheet that says "give us our money."

One of them got off the crane to deal with the Trade Union. Hereafter, even the police and the firefighters came to the place, as well as the mayor of Cavaria Alberto Tovaglieri.

The construction company that was building some blocks with a total of 80 apartments is now facing financial problems due to the bankruptcy of the Castelli company, located in Como, which had subcontracted the subcontract they had been assigned by the San Quirico company of Mariano Comense: the workers have not received their salaries since June, and the construction was halted a few months ago. Another company will probably take over and complete the construction, but it is still uncertain.

At about 2 p.m. the workers came down from the crane, thanks to the intervention of two trade union representatives, who not only convinced them to make a reasonable choice, but also partly unlocked the financial situation, as the liquidator of the Castelli company promised each one of the five workers the amount of €2000.
